How much does General Atomics pay in Indiana?

The average General Atomics salary in Indiana is $55,353. General Atomics salaries range between $32,000 to $93,000 per year in Indiana. General Atomics Indiana based pay is lower than General Atomics's United States average salary of $62,171. The best-paying job in Indiana at General Atomics is researcher, which pays an average of $145,329 annually.

General Atomics salaries in Indiana by department

The departments with the highest salaries for General Atomics employees in Indiana are Research & Development, Sales, and Engineering.

Indiana General Atomics employees in the Research & Development department earn an average salary of $82,723 a year, compared to an average salary of $80,516 in the Sales department and $72,448 in the Engineering department.
